Understanding the Core Technology Behind the Initiative
At its foundation, Vanderburgh Sheriff: How Technology is Revolutionizing Law Enforcement focuses on integrating digital tools into existing workflows to improve accuracy and speed. For example, departments may utilize advanced data analytics platforms to identify crime patterns, allowing for more strategic deployment of patrols in high-need areas. Mobile applications can enable officers to access critical information in real-time during field operations, such as checking vehicle registrations or verifying identities securely from a patrol car. Hypothetically, an analytics system might flag recurring incidents at specific intersections, helping commanders decide where to adjust traffic signage or increase visibility. These technologies work together to create a more connected and informed operational environment while adhering to established legal frameworks.
Real-World Applications and Practical Implementation
Practical use of Vanderburgh Sheriff: How Technology is Revolutionizing Law Enforcement often centers on communication and information management. Consider a scenario where digital case management tools streamline evidence tracking, reducing administrative burdens and minimizing human error. Body-worn cameras and integrated recording systems help ensure interactions are documented, supporting both officer safety and community transparency. Predictive policing technologies, when used within ethical guidelines, can assist in forecasting where resources might be most effective without targeting individuals. Training programs typically accompany these tools to ensure personnel understand both capabilities and limitations. The goal is consistent: enhance public safety operations through thoughtful, responsible technology adoption.
